Filters:
clear
manufacturer
clear
Bury St Edmunds
clear
Country: United Kingdom

manufacturer in Bury St Edmunds

About 1 results.

Price Turfcare

thumb_up 77 likes
favorite 1 favorites
Oak Farm, Cockfield, IP30 0JH Bury St Edmunds, United Kingdom

Suppliers of superior branded turf and ground care equipment.

  • 1